DBA Data[Home] [Help]

APPS.GMO_INSTRUCTION_PVT dependencies on GMO_INSTR_DEFN_T

Line 552: INSERT INTO GMO_INSTR_DEFN_T

548: LOOP
549: FETCH L_GMO_INSTR_CSR INTO L_GMO_INSTR_REC;
550: EXIT WHEN L_GMO_INSTR_CSR%NOTFOUND;
551:
552: INSERT INTO GMO_INSTR_DEFN_T
553: (
554: INSTRUCTION_PROCESS_ID,
555: INSTRUCTION_ID,
556: INSTRUCTION_SET_ID,

Line 961: DELETE FROM GMO_INSTR_DEFN_T WHERE INSTRUCTION_PROCESS_ID = X_INSTRUCTION_PROCESS_ID;

957: P_UPDATE_DEFN_STATUS => FND_API.G_TRUE);
958:
959: --Delete the contents of Temp Table for the specified process ID.
960: DELETE FROM GMO_INSTR_APPR_DEFN_T WHERE INSTRUCTION_PROCESS_ID = X_INSTRUCTION_PROCESS_ID;
961: DELETE FROM GMO_INSTR_DEFN_T WHERE INSTRUCTION_PROCESS_ID = X_INSTRUCTION_PROCESS_ID;
962: DELETE FROM GMO_INSTR_SET_DEFN_T WHERE INSTRUCTION_PROCESS_ID = X_INSTRUCTION_PROCESS_ID;
963:
964: -- COMMIT CHANGES
965: COMMIT;

Line 1447: FROM GMO_INSTR_DEFN_T

1443: SELECT INSTRUCTION_PROCESS_ID, INSTRUCTION_ID, INSTRUCTION_SET_ID,
1444: INSTRUCTION_TEXT, INSTR_SEQ, TASK_ID, TASK_ATTRIBUTE_ID,
1445: TASK_ATTRIBUTE, INSTR_ACKN_TYPE, INSTR_NUMBER, CREATION_DATE,
1446: CREATED_BY, LAST_UPDATE_DATE, LAST_UPDATED_BY, LAST_UPDATE_LOGIN, TASK_LABEL
1447: FROM GMO_INSTR_DEFN_T
1448: WHERE INSTRUCTION_PROCESS_ID = P_INSTRUCTION_PROCESS_ID
1449: AND INSTRUCTION_SET_ID = L_INSTRUCTION_SET_ID
1450: ORDER BY INSTR_SEQ, INSTRUCTION_ID;
1451:

Line 1512: SELECT INSTRUCTION_ID, INSTR_SEQ INTO L_TEMP_INSTR_ID, L_TEMP_INSTR_SEQ FROM GMO_INSTR_DEFN_T

1508: L_PERM_INSTR_ID NUMBER;
1509: L_TEMP_INSTR_SEQ NUMBER;
1510:
1511: CURSOR L_TEMP_INSTR_CHK_CSR IS
1512: SELECT INSTRUCTION_ID, INSTR_SEQ INTO L_TEMP_INSTR_ID, L_TEMP_INSTR_SEQ FROM GMO_INSTR_DEFN_T
1513: WHERE INSTRUCTION_PROCESS_ID = P_INSTRUCTION_PROCESS_ID
1514: AND INSTRUCTION_SET_ID = L_PERM_INSTRUCTION_SET_ID
1515: ORDER BY INSTR_SEQ ;
1516:

Line 1699: UPDATE GMO_INSTR_DEFN_T

1695: AND ENTITY_NAME = L_ENTITY_NAME
1696: AND ENTITY_KEY = L_TARGET_ENTITY_KEY
1697: AND INSTRUCTION_TYPE = L_INSTRUCTION_TYPE;
1698:
1699: UPDATE GMO_INSTR_DEFN_T
1700: SET INSTRUCTION_SET_ID = L_PERM_INSTRUCTION_SET_ID
1701: WHERE INSTRUCTION_PROCESS_ID = P_INSTRUCTION_PROCESS_ID
1702: AND INSTRUCTION_SET_ID = L_TEMP_INSTRUCTION_SET_ID;
1703:

Line 1718: update gmo_instr_defn_t set instruction_id = L_PERM_INSTR_ID where instruction_id = l_temp_instr_id;

1714: exception
1715: when no_data_found then
1716: SELECT GMO_INSTR_DEFN_S.NEXTVAL INTO L_PERM_INSTR_ID FROM DUAL;
1717: end;
1718: update gmo_instr_defn_t set instruction_id = L_PERM_INSTR_ID where instruction_id = l_temp_instr_id;
1719: update gmo_instr_appr_defn_t set instruction_id = L_PERM_INSTR_ID where instruction_id = l_temp_instr_id;
1720: END LOOP;
1721: CLOSE L_TEMP_INSTR_CHK_CSR;
1722: --Bug 5020834: end

Line 1889: UPDATE GMO_INSTR_DEFN_TL SET

1885: LAST_UPDATE_LOGIN = L_LAST_UPDATE_LOGIN
1886: WHERE INSTRUCTION_ID = L_TEMP_INSTR_DEFN_REC.INSTRUCTION_ID
1887: AND INSTRUCTION_SET_ID = L_TEMP_INSTR_DEFN_REC.INSTRUCTION_SET_ID;
1888:
1889: UPDATE GMO_INSTR_DEFN_TL SET
1890: INSTRUCTION_TEXT = L_TEMP_INSTR_DEFN_REC.INSTRUCTION_TEXT,
1891: TASK_LABEL = L_TEMP_INSTR_DEFN_REC.TASK_LABEL,
1892: LAST_UPDATE_DATE = L_LAST_UPDATE_DATE,
1893: LAST_UPDATED_BY = L_LAST_UPDATED_BY,

Line 2052: DELETE FROM GMO_INSTR_DEFN_TL

2048: CLOSE L_TEMP_INSTR_DEFN_CSR;
2049:
2050: --Cleanup deleted records from instruction table
2051: --Bug 5224619: start
2052: DELETE FROM GMO_INSTR_DEFN_TL
2053: WHERE INSTRUCTION_ID NOT IN
2054: ( SELECT INSTRUCTION_ID FROM GMO_INSTR_DEFN_T WHERE INSTRUCTION_PROCESS_ID = P_INSTRUCTION_PROCESS_ID
2055: AND INSTRUCTION_SET_ID = L_INSTRUCTION_SET_ID)
2056: AND INSTRUCTION_ID IN (SELECT INSTRUCTION_ID FROM GMO_INSTR_DEFN_B WHERE INSTRUCTION_SET_ID = L_INSTRUCTION_SET_ID)

Line 2054: ( SELECT INSTRUCTION_ID FROM GMO_INSTR_DEFN_T WHERE INSTRUCTION_PROCESS_ID = P_INSTRUCTION_PROCESS_ID

2050: --Cleanup deleted records from instruction table
2051: --Bug 5224619: start
2052: DELETE FROM GMO_INSTR_DEFN_TL
2053: WHERE INSTRUCTION_ID NOT IN
2054: ( SELECT INSTRUCTION_ID FROM GMO_INSTR_DEFN_T WHERE INSTRUCTION_PROCESS_ID = P_INSTRUCTION_PROCESS_ID
2055: AND INSTRUCTION_SET_ID = L_INSTRUCTION_SET_ID)
2056: AND INSTRUCTION_ID IN (SELECT INSTRUCTION_ID FROM GMO_INSTR_DEFN_B WHERE INSTRUCTION_SET_ID = L_INSTRUCTION_SET_ID)
2057: AND LANGUAGE=USERENV('LANG');
2058:

Line 2062: ( SELECT INSTRUCTION_ID FROM GMO_INSTR_DEFN_T WHERE INSTRUCTION_PROCESS_ID = P_INSTRUCTION_PROCESS_ID

2058:
2059: DELETE FROM GMO_INSTR_DEFN_B
2060: WHERE INSTRUCTION_SET_ID = L_INSTRUCTION_SET_ID
2061: AND INSTRUCTION_ID NOT IN
2062: ( SELECT INSTRUCTION_ID FROM GMO_INSTR_DEFN_T WHERE INSTRUCTION_PROCESS_ID = P_INSTRUCTION_PROCESS_ID
2063: AND INSTRUCTION_SET_ID = L_INSTRUCTION_SET_ID);
2064: --Bug 5224619: end
2065:
2066: END LOOP;

Line 2109: DELETE FROM GMO_INSTR_DEFN_TL WHERE INSTRUCTION_ID IN

2105: WHERE INSTRUCTION_SET_ID = L_DEL_INSTR_SET_ID);
2106:
2107: -- Second remove the instructions
2108: --Bug 5224619: start
2109: DELETE FROM GMO_INSTR_DEFN_TL WHERE INSTRUCTION_ID IN
2110: (SELECT INSTRUCTION_ID FROM GMO_INSTR_DEFN_B WHERE INSTRUCTION_SET_ID = L_DEL_INSTR_SET_ID) AND LANGUAGE=USERENV('LANG');
2111:
2112: DELETE FROM GMO_INSTR_DEFN_B
2113: WHERE INSTRUCTION_SET_ID = L_DEL_INSTR_SET_ID;

Line 5865: FROM GMO_INSTR_DEFN_T INSTR

5861: AS SIGNATURE_REQUIRED
5862: )
5863: )
5864: )
5865: FROM GMO_INSTR_DEFN_T INSTR
5866: WHERE INSTR.INSTRUCTION_SET_ID = INSTR_SET.INSTRUCTION_SET_ID
5867: AND INSTR.INSTRUCTION_PROCESS_ID = INSTR_SET.INSTRUCTION_PROCESS_ID) AS "RELATED_INSTRUCTIONS")
5868: )
5869: )

Line 6013: select count(*) from gmo_instr_defn_t where

6009: where instruction_set_id = P_INSTRUCTION_SET_ID
6010: and instruction_process_id = P_INSTRUCTION_PROCESS_ID;
6011: -- Bug 5686314 : rvsingh :start
6012: cursor task_count_per_inst_set is
6013: select count(*) from gmo_instr_defn_t where
6014: instruction_process_id = p_instruction_process_id
6015: AND instruction_set_id = p_instruction_set_id
6016: AND task_id =l_task_id;
6017:

Line 6050: from gmo_instr_defn_t

6046: if (l_count > 0) then
6047:
6048: if (p_instruction_id is not null) then
6049: select instr_seq into l_instr_seq
6050: from gmo_instr_defn_t
6051: where instruction_set_id = P_INSTRUCTION_SET_ID
6052: and instruction_process_id = P_INSTRUCTION_PROCESS_ID
6053: and instruction_id = P_INSTRUCTION_ID;
6054:

Line 6062: update gmo_instr_defn_t

6058: elsif (P_ADD_MODE = 'BEFORE') then
6059: l_working_instr_seq := l_instr_seq;
6060: end if;
6061:
6062: update gmo_instr_defn_t
6063: set instr_seq = instr_seq + l_count
6064: where instruction_set_id = P_INSTRUCTION_SET_ID
6065: and instruction_process_id = P_INSTRUCTION_PROCESS_ID
6066: and instr_seq >= l_working_instr_seq;

Line 6076: from gmo_instr_defn_t

6072: end if;
6073:
6074: if (l_working_instr_seq = 0) then
6075: select nvl(max(instr_seq), 0) into l_working_instr_seq
6076: from gmo_instr_defn_t
6077: where instruction_set_id = P_INSTRUCTION_SET_ID
6078: and instruction_process_id = P_INSTRUCTION_PROCESS_ID;
6079:
6080: l_working_instr_seq := l_working_instr_seq + 1;

Line 6108: insert into gmo_instr_defn_t

6104: end if;
6105:
6106: select gmo_instr_defn_s.nextval into l_working_instruction_id from dual;
6107:
6108: insert into gmo_instr_defn_t
6109: (instruction_id,
6110: instruction_process_id,
6111: instruction_text,
6112: instruction_set_id,

Line 6152: X_to_entity_name => 'GMO_INSTR_DEFN_T',

6148: X_from_pk2_value => NULL,
6149: X_from_pk3_value => NULL,
6150: X_from_pk4_value => NULL,
6151: X_from_pk5_value => NULL,
6152: X_to_entity_name => 'GMO_INSTR_DEFN_T',
6153: X_to_pk1_value => l_working_instruction_id,
6154: X_to_pk2_value => P_INSTRUCTION_PROCESS_ID,
6155: X_to_pk3_value => NULL,
6156: X_to_pk4_value => NULL,

Line 6430: from gmo_instr_defn_t

6426: l_total_count := l_count;
6427:
6428: else
6429: select count(*) into l_count
6430: from gmo_instr_defn_t
6431: where instruction_process_id = l_instruction_process_id
6432: and task_attribute_id like l_check_attribute;
6433:
6434: l_total_count := l_count;